The York School proved the old saying: take care of the pennies and the dollars will take care of themselves. The students raised more than $1,000 with a penny drive, part of a successful campaign, which raised a total of $4,832! Way to go York School.

Schools and youth groups across Toronto run Youthunited Campaigns under the leadership of one or more Youthunited Ambassadors.

In 2007, 86 schools across Toronto raised $230,000!  Were you one of them?

The Loonie Drive and the Enbridge CN Tower Student Climb are the heart of the Youthunited Campaign.  Creative schools raise money for both through fun special events.  You can check out our 2008 Spirit Award winners for some exceptional Youthunited Campaign ideas!
